Ohio State’s Comprehensive Spine Center creates a direct link between your primary care provider and the management of your spine injuries. The Comprehensive Spine Center provides a full scope of spinal services including the evaluation, treatment and rehabilitation of conditions of the cervical, thoracic and lumbar spine. Working together with referring physicians, the OSU Comprehensive Spine Center’s team ensures that each patient receives a personalized treatment plan specific to his or her circumstance and lifestyle.
The Comprehensive Spine Center brings together a team of specialists in the areas of physical medicine and rehabilitation, interventional pain management, neurosurgery, orthopaedics, physical therapy and nursing to provide complete and expert care for your spine conditions.
Our Center is equipped with the most state-of-the-art imaging and diagnostic technology which enables our spine specialists to effectively and accurately diagnose and treat you. We also offer a full range of leading-edge, surgical and non-surgical treatment options.
